1. Vienna: The Heart of Central Europe
Vienna, the capital of Austria, sits right in the heart of Central Europe. Nestled along the Danube River, it’s a crossroads of Eastern and Western cultures, making it a melting pot of influences. Imagine standing at the intersection of history and modernity, where the echoes of Mozart and Beethoven blend with the buzz of contemporary cafes and street art. 🎼🏙️
Geographically, Vienna is positioned in the northeastern part of Austria, bordering Slovakia and the Czech Republic. This strategic location has historically made it a hub for trade, diplomacy, and cultural exchange. In fact, its central position was so significant that it served as the seat of power for the Habsburg Empire, influencing the political landscape of Europe for centuries. 🏰🗺️
2. Cultural Significance and Global Influence
Vienna isn’t just a dot on the map; it’s a vibrant cultural center that continues to influence the world. From the grandeur of Schönbrunn Palace to the intellectual debates at Café Central, Vienna’s cultural impact is profound. It’s where psychoanalysis was born, where classical music flourished, and where the arts continue to thrive. 🎭🎨
The city’s cultural significance extends beyond its borders, attracting millions of tourists each year who come to experience its rich history and vibrant present. Vienna’s museums, concert halls, and historic sites draw visitors from around the globe, making it a must-visit destination for anyone interested in history, art, and culture. 🌍👀
3. Exploring Vienna: Tips for Visitors
Ready to explore Vienna for yourself? Start by getting a lay of the land. The city is divided into 23 districts, each with its own unique character. The historic center, including the Hofburg Palace and St. Stephen’s Cathedral, is a great starting point. For a taste of local life, wander through the Mariahilfer Straße, Vienna’s main shopping street, or enjoy a coffee in a traditional Viennese café. ☕🚶♂️
Don’t forget to venture outside the city limits to experience the stunning landscapes surrounding Vienna. The nearby Vienna Woods offer beautiful hikes and scenic views, while the Wachau Valley is perfect for a day trip to explore charming villages and vineyards. 🍇🏞️
